New Max-Trax Feature Helps Pilots Gain Best Fuel Prices

Source: fly-corporate.com

Globalair.com has launched a new functionality for its Max-Trax route planning web-based application to help pilots gain the best fuel prices throughout their trip and determine the most effective flight path.

The new functionality includes a corridor search option in the trip options section of the service. This functionality lets users search fuel prices within 25, 50, 75, and 100 nautical miles of their planned route, assisting pilots in finding the best fuel price between each leg of the trip.

Also added to the trip options section of Max-Trax is the ability to search for airports available by approach types. Max-Trax combines FBO-updated fuel pricing with a user's specific aircraft range data and departure and destination information to map out complete itineraries that can be saved, e-mailed, or printed.

Trip information is shown on a graphical map that displays all stops plus pop-up balloons that offer detailed information specific to those airports or FBOs.
